Background
The pultruded tiles are formed by rolling and cold bending steel plates into profiled plates with various wave patterns, are suitable for roofs, wall surfaces, inner and outer wall decorations and the like of industrial and civil buildings, warehouses, special buildings and large-span steel structure houses, have the characteristics of light weight, high strength, rich colors, convenient and quick construction, earthquake resistance, fire resistance, rain resistance, long service life, maintenance-free property and the like, and are widely popularized and applied. However, for some special plants such as smelting and chemical plants, the steel plate tile is subject to over-fast corrosion, and the surface of the pultruded tile is often sprayed with anticorrosive powder coating.
In the prior art, the pultruded tiles are connected and fixed by screws in the installation process, so that the labor capacity is large and the assembling efficiency is low; the traditional mode that the slots on two sides are pushed into the clamping connection from the end part is difficult to assemble in a place with limited space; therefore, the utility model provides a fine polyester composite pultrusion tile of the fine polyester of anticorrosive lock joint of being convenient for is used for solving above-mentioned problem.

Referring to fig. 1 to 3, the present invention provides a technical solution: an anticorrosion glass fiber polyester composite pultrusion tile convenient for buckling comprises a pultrusion tile 1, wherein an upper splicing groove 2 is formed in the surface of the pultrusion tile 1, a lower splicing groove 3 is formed in the surface of the pultrusion tile 1, the pultrusion tile 1 is of an inverted 'convex' shaped frame structure, the upper splicing groove 2 and the lower splicing groove 3 are both of square structures, when the two pultrusion tiles 1 are spliced, the upper splicing groove 2 and the lower splicing groove 3 are spliced in a staggered manner, limiting grooves 4 are formed in the surfaces of the upper splicing groove 2 and the pultrusion tile 1, the limiting grooves 4 are connected with flexible blocking strips 5 in a matched manner, the flexible blocking strips 5 are fixed on the surface of the pultrusion tile 1, flexible blocking strips 6 are arranged on the surface of the pultrusion tile 1, the limiting grooves 4 are of an arc-shaped cylinder structure, the flexible blocking strips 5 are of an arc-shaped strip structure, the length of the long edges of the limiting grooves 4 is equal to that of the long edges of the pultrusion tile 1, and the flexible blocking strips 6 are of an arc-shaped strip structure, two groups of flexible barrier strips 6 are arranged, and the two groups of flexible barrier strips 6 are vertically and symmetrically distributed relative to the limiting groove 4;
the top surface of lower floor's piece together group groove 3 is provided with lock joint frame 7, be provided with set screw 8 on the roof of lock joint frame 7, lock joint frame 7 inserts in connecting hole 9, lock joint frame 7 is "Contraband" font structure frame construction, the spiro union is at the top surface of lower floor's piece together group groove 3 behind set screw 8 runs through the roof of lock joint frame 7, connecting hole 9 is "protruding" font cylinder structure, connecting hole 9 is seted up the bottom surface at upper strata piece together group groove 2, the bottom of lock joint frame 7 is provided with dop 10, finger groove 11 has been seted up on dop 10's surface, dop 10 is right trapezoid cylinder structure, dop 10's inclined plane is down, finger groove 11 is circular groove structure.
The working principle is as follows: in practical use, referring to fig. 2, after the left side pultruded tile 1 is placed, the right side pultruded tile 1 is lapped on the left side pultruded tile 1 from top to bottom, the lower layer assembling groove 3 at the left end of the right side pultruded tile 1 is spliced with the upper layer assembling groove 2 at the right end of the left side pultruded tile 1 in a staggered manner, the right side pultruded tile 1 is pressed downwards, the fastening frame 7 is inserted into the connecting hole 9, the pressing is continued until the clamping head 10 is positioned at the lower part of the stepped surface of the connecting hole 9, the top plane of the clamping head 10 is abutted against the stepped groove surface of the connecting hole 9, the fastening frame 7 is prevented from moving back upwards, the flexible clamping strip 5 is abutted into the limiting groove 4 at the moment, the flexible blocking strip 6 is extruded between the two pultruded tiles 1, the fingers are engaged into the finger grooves 11, the bottom ends of the two vertical plates of the fastening frame 7 are pressed inwards, the distance between the bottom ends of the two vertical plates is reduced until the clamping head 10 can pass through the connecting hole 9, and the fastening frame 7 can be pushed out from the connecting hole 9, the splitting of the two pultruded tiles 1 is realized.
